National Bank Holdings Corporation (NYSE:NBHC –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ant decline in short interest in the month of December. As of December 31st, there was short interest totaling 540,774 shares, a decline of 19.8% from the December 15th total of 674,113 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 331,215 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 1.6 days. Approximately 1.5% of the company’s shares are short sold. National Bank (NYSE:NBHC –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, October 21st. The financial services provider reported $0.96 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.90 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$108.89 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$107.56 million. National Bank had a return on equity of 9.56% and a net margin of 20.50%.The business’s revenue was up 6.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$0.86 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ts expect that National Bank will post 3.31 EPS for the current year.

About National Bank
National Bank Holdings Corporation (NYSE: NBHC) is a diversified financial services holding company headquartered in Cape Girardeau, Missouri. Through its network of community bank subsidiaries, the company provides deposit, lending and payment solutions to consumer, small business and commercial clients across multiple U.S. markets.
Since its founding in 1992, National Bank Holdings has pursued a growth strategy focused on acquiring and integrating locally branded community banks. Its footprint spans the Midwest and Southern United States, including Missouri, Kansas, Oklahoma, Texas, Colorado, Illinois and Tennessee.
